About the role As the Strategy, Commercial Performance & Governance Risk Manager you will provide first line risk leadership support to the Commercial Performance & Governance (CP&G) team (encompassing EPMO, Strategic Sourcing and Commercial Finance), and the Strategy team. Reporting into the General Manager - Commercial Performance and Governance, you will be responsible for embedding a strong risk culture and ensuring effective risk management practices are deployed that align to the ART Group Risk Management Framework (RMF) within CP&G and Strategy.
Day to day, you'll: - Develop and maintain the risk profile for CP&G and Strategy, including oversight of their Business Area Risk Registers.
- Ensure risk exposures remain within appetite and lead the development of mitigation plans where thresholds are exceeded.
- Embed risk management into strategic planning, procurement lifecycle, and financial forecasting, ensuring alignment with ART’s risk appetite and business objectives.
- Conduct proactive risk assessments across sourcing strategies, supplier engagements, strategic initiatives, and financial planning cycles.
- Partner with the relevant stakeholders to deliver risk reporting and insights to senior executives, committees, and the Board, with a focus on financial, strategic, and third-party risk.
- Manage the effective delivery of remediation actions and plans to address control gaps and improve the management of risks.
- Coordinate audit and assurance activities, including internal audits, regulatory reviews, and third-party assurance engagements.
- Ensure high-quality data and insights are used in risk reporting and decision-making.

It's quite likely you tick some of the following boxes too: - Strong understanding of risk management frameworks, methodologies and controls, particularly in a transformational change environment.
- Knowledge of enterprise risk, operational risk and compliance requirements.
- Familiarity with change management, project governance and business transformation principles.
- Strong stakeholder engagement and ability to influence, particularly in complex organisational structures and transformation teams.
- Proven experience in a Line 1 risk management role, ideally within a Finance or Procurement environment.
- Demonstrated ability to develop and implement risk controls, assessments and mitigation strategies.
- Experience in risk reporting, governance forums and risk monitoring.
- Strong knowledge of APRA Risk Management Prudential Standards, operational risk, compliance frameworks, and control assurance processes.
